Upwork Inc. priced its initial public offering at a higher price than expected Tuesday evening, and will raise at least $187 million. The software company, which focuses on freelance workers, said it would sell about 12.48 million shares at $15 apiece, after previously aiming for a price range of $12 to $14. Upwork will raise at least $187.1 million at a valuation topping $1.5 billion at that price, though the shares provided in the sale are split between the company and early investors, so the proceeds will be as well.
